In 1880s, Tolbert Lanston invented the Monotype System, which consisted of a keyboard (typesetting machine) and a composition caster. The tape, punched with the keyboard, was later read by the caster, which produced lead type according to the combinations of holes in 0, 1, or more of 31 positions. The tape reader used compressed air, which passed through the holes and was directed into certain mechanisms of the caster. The system went into commercial use in 1897 and was in production well into the 1970s, undergoing several changes along the way.

[38] In the 1970s through the early 1980s, paper tape was commonly used to transfer binary data for incorporation in either mask-programmable read-only memory (ROM) chips or their erasable counterparts EPROMs. A significant variety of encoding formats were developed for use in computer and ROM/EPROM data transfer. [7] Encoding formats commonly used were primarily driven by those formats that EPROM programming devices supported and included various ASCII hex variants as well as a number of proprietary formats. With a parity bit, on an eight-hole tape, you have seven bits to encode with. 1111111 in binary is 127 in decimal, meaning you have 128 different codes that can be punched into the tape—if you take 0000000 as the first code. These codes can be assigned to binary data values, op-codes, or they could be assigned to values representing letters. Human accessibility. The hole patterns can be decoded visually if necessary, and torn tape can be repaired (using special all-hole pattern tape splices). Editing text on a punched tape was achieved by literally cutting and pasting the tape with scissors, glue, or by taping over a section to cover all holes and making new holes using a manual hole punch.

The tapes the NSA creates contain cryptographic keys or seed values for cryptography algorithms. These were distributed to whoever required them—such as the UK’s General Communications Headquarters (GCHQ)—in tamper-proof plastic containers. Operators typed in the message to the paper tape, and then sent the message at the maximum line speed from the tape. This permitted the operator to prepare the message "off-line" at the operator's best typing speed, and permitted the operator to correct any error prior to transmission. Carroll [71] developed a series of rotary presses that were used to produce punched cards, including a 1921 model that operated at 460 cards per minute (cpm). In 1936 he introduced a completely different press that operated at 850 cpm. [22] [72] Carroll's high-speed press, containing a printing cylinder, revolutionized the company's manufacturing of punched cards.
